发展了乙基锌对原位产生的不饱和亚胺的对映选择性共轭加成,磺酰吲哚衍生物在乙基锌存在下原位生成不饱和亚胺,手性亚磷酰胺配体-铜络合物催化二乙基锌对该原位产生的不饱和亚胺反应以最高99%的产率和80%的对映选择性得到了一系列3位取代的光学活性的吲哚衍生物.
